diff options
Diffstat (limited to 'bitbake/bin/bitbake-worker')
| -rwxr-xr-x | bitbake/bin/bitbake-worker |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/bitbake/bin/bitbake-worker b/bitbake/bin/bitbake-worker index db3c4b184f..8d043946cb 100755 --- a/bitbake/bin/bitbake-worker +++ b/bitbake/bin/bitbake-worker | |||
| @@ -228,7 +228,7 @@ def fork_off_task(cfg, data, databuilder, workerdata, fn, task, taskname, append | |||
| 228 | the_data = bb_cache.loadDataFull(fn, appends) | 228 | the_data = bb_cache.loadDataFull(fn, appends) |
| 229 | the_data.setVar('BB_TASKHASH', workerdata["runq_hash"][task]) | 229 | the_data.setVar('BB_TASKHASH', workerdata["runq_hash"][task]) |
| 230 | 230 | ||
| 231 | bb.utils.set_process_name("%s:%s" % (the_data.getVar("PN", True), taskname.replace("do_", ""))) | 231 | bb.utils.set_process_name("%s:%s" % (the_data.getVar("PN"), taskname.replace("do_", ""))) |
| 232 | 232 | ||
| 233 | # exported_vars() returns a generator which *cannot* be passed to os.environ.update() | 233 | # exported_vars() returns a generator which *cannot* be passed to os.environ.update() |
| 234 | # successfully. We also need to unset anything from the environment which shouldn't be there | 234 | # successfully. We also need to unset anything from the environment which shouldn't be there |
| @@ -247,7 +247,7 @@ def fork_off_task(cfg, data, databuilder, workerdata, fn, task, taskname, append | |||
| 247 | if task_exports: | 247 | if task_exports: |
| 248 | for e in task_exports.split(): | 248 | for e in task_exports.split(): |
| 249 | the_data.setVarFlag(e, 'export', '1') | 249 | the_data.setVarFlag(e, 'export', '1') |
| 250 | v = the_data.getVar(e, True) | 250 | v = the_data.getVar(e) |
| 251 | if v is not None: | 251 | if v is not None: |
| 252 | os.environ[e] = v | 252 | os.environ[e] = v |
| 253 | 253 | ||
